In the past four years, the state flagship universities of <a href=\"https:\/\/www.bangordailynews.com\/2022\/09\/18\/bangor\/maine-campus-student-newspaper-joam40zk0w\/\">Maine<\/a>,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.kosu.org\/local-news\/2025-08-14\/uco-ends-print-publication-of-student-newspaper?#:~:text=University%20of%20Missouri%E2%80%99s\">Missouri<\/a>, and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.kosu.org\/local-news\/2025-08-14\/uco-ends-print-publication-of-student-newspaper?#:~:text=University%20of%20Oklahoma%E2%80%99s\">Oklahoma<\/a> have shifted their student newspapers from print to online-only editions.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>At EMU, the ink and newsprint are still very much alive. Every two weeks during the school year, a dynamic team of writers, editors, designers, and photographers works to put together and publish <a href=\"https:\/\/www.theweathervane.org\/\"><strong><em>The Weather Vane<\/em><\/strong><\/a>. The student-run print newspaper, which averages 12 pages of stories and color photos per issue, captures the buzz on campus through reporting and perspectives on campus policies, cultural trends, and national politics.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The half-broadsheet (a term referring to the paper\u2019s physical size) prints 14 issues each academic year and is in its 72nd volume. Dycus<\/strong>, \u201chas been very supportive of what we do.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Sitara Hackney<\/strong>, managing editor for <em>The Weather Vane<\/em>, agreed. \u201cWe try and encourage people to express themselves as they want,\u201d said Hackney, a junior history and education major in her sixth semester with the paper. \u201cAs copy editors, part of our job is changing what people write, but it\u2019s still their names getting printed with their articles.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\" \/>\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-image\">\n<figure class=\"aligncenter size-large is-resized\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"615\" src=\"https:\/\/emu-wordpress-multisite-instance-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/43\/2026\/03\/11120323\/WeatherVane10-1024x615.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-60790\" style=\"width:650px\" srcset=\"https:\/\/emu-wordpress-multisite-instance-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/43\/2026\/03\/11120323\/WeatherVane10-1024x615.jpeg 1024w, https:\/\/emu-wordpress-multisite-instance-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/43\/2026\/03\/11120323\/WeatherVane10-300x180.jpeg 300w, https:\/\/emu-wordpress-multisite-instance-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/43\/2026\/03\/11120323\/WeatherVane10-768x461.jpeg 768w, https:\/\/emu-wordpress-multisite-instance-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/43\/2026\/03\/11120323\/WeatherVane10.jpeg 1280w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><figcaption class=\"wp-element-caption\"><strong>Campus Life Editor Micah Wenger hard at work editing a story for The Weather Vane during a production night on Jan. 21.<\/strong><\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<\/div>\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\" \/>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">From plan to print<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>It\u2019s just past 5:30 p.m. on a Wednesday in January when Metzler and Belisle call the production night meeting, their first of the spring 2026 semester, to order. They stand in front of a whiteboard in the basement lounge of Maplewood Residence Hall, dry erase markers in hand.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cWhat is everybody interested in writing about?\u201d Metzler asks the group of 10 students.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Staff Writer <strong>Samuel Castaneda<\/strong> calls out an idea for an <a href=\"https:\/\/www.theweathervane.org\/waking-up-at-8-a-m-on-a-snow-day-shouldnt-exist\/opinion\/\">opinion piece<\/a>: \u201cHaving an 8 a.m. virtual class on a snow day is not something that should happen.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Another student pitches a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.theweathervane.org\/online-training-brings-awareness-to-hazing\/news-and-feature\/\">story<\/a> on the hazing training required for all EMU employees. \u201cMaybe there\u2019s a story there,\u201d ponders Metzler. \u201cWhat\u2019s EMU\u2019s history with hazing?\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>After his older brother, Campus Life Editor and <a href=\"https:\/\/www.theweathervane.org\/the-texas-inns-great-bowl-of-fire\/review\/\">champion chili eater<\/a> <strong>Micah Wenger<\/strong>, suggests getting tickets to see a one-woman show, <em>Sell Me: I am from North Korea<\/em>, at James Madison University\u2019s Forbes Center for the Performing Arts, first-year student and Opinion Editor <strong>Reuben Wenger<\/strong> agrees to <a href=\"https:\/\/www.theweathervane.org\/sell-me-i-am-from-north-korea\/review\/\">review it<\/a> for the paper.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>There\u2019s almost always space in the paper for the word search, sudoku, and maze puzzles contributed by Copy Editor <strong>Ethan Kanagy<\/strong>. It\u2019s typically among the most popular sections of <em>The Weather Vane<\/em>, says Belisle.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cI\u2019ve seen people in the caf doing the puzzles,\u201d he says.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cWe hear complaints when there aren\u2019t any puzzles,\u201d Metzler chimes in.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>After collecting story ideas for the issue coming out in two weeks, the co-editors-in-chief lead their team of staffers into the <em>Weather Vane<\/em> newsroom to put together the next day\u2019s paper. Fueled by camaraderie and slices of Marco\u2019s Pizza, the students work through the night editing and designing pages until the paper is put to bed (meaning it\u2019s finished and ready to print). On Thursday morning, the newspaper will be printed at a site about 40 minutes away and delivered to campus later that afternoon.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Despite the pitches they hear at the planning meeting, one unexpected event ends up dominating the front page. Four nights later, a burst of extremely cold weather causes a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.theweathervane.org\/flood-temporarily-forces-students-out-of-hillside\/news-and-feature\/\">sprinkler malfunction<\/a> inside one of the residence halls. It isn\u2019t until 2 a.m. that the issue finally comes together.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\" \/>\n\n\n\n<p>For more information about <em>The Weather Vane<\/em>, contact faculty advisor <strong>Mary Ann Zehr <\/strong>at maryann.zehr@emu.edu or the student editors at wvane@emu.edu.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Campus newspaper gives students a voice It\u2019s no secret that print newspapers are an endangered species.
